The author proves the following theorem: Let \(|{\mathcal S}| =k> \aleph_0\), \(A_\alpha\), \(1 \leq \alpha < \omega_m\), are \(m\) subsets of \({\mathcal S}\), if \(m>k\). Then there are \(m\) disjoint sets of indices \(I_\gamma\) so that the \(m\) sets \(\bigcup_{j \in I_\gamma} A_j\) are all equal. If \(m \leq k\) the theorem is not true.
